EditEmtrain is a company focused on creating healthy and respectful workplace cultures by providing training solutions to combat harassment and bias. Serving large and high-growth clients such as Netflix, Chevron, Workday, Yelp, and the New York Times, Emtrain operates in the corporate training and human resources market. The business model revolves around offering subscription-based access to their training platform, which includes courses on sexual harassment, unconscious bias, diversity and inclusion, workplace culture, code of conduct, and FCPA compliance. Emtrain generates revenue through these subscriptions, targeting companies that recognize the importance of a strong workplace culture as a driver of growth and value.
